Theres smaller soft boxes that have a height and width of about 30 centimeters folded out. They won't cost you much.
You can also just use a few ordinary house lamps. You could also change the bulbs of those to a daylight bulb instead of the more yellow light that they usually make. Just make sure the fitting is the same.
@Stike96 The basic set-up requires 3 lights. One key, one fill and one highlight/hairlight. You put 2 lights on the front of the subject and one in the back.
